PAWPAW DRINK
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Breakfast & Brunch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Scoop papaya flesh into a blender jar. Add orange and lime juices, ginger, honey, and ice cubes. Blend until combined. Divide between 2 glasses; serve immediately.

Tips:
- Choose ripe pawpaws. The best pawpaws for this drink are those that are slightly soft to the touch and have a yellow-orange hue.
- If you can't find fresh pawpaws, you can use frozen pawpaw pulp. Just thaw the pulp before using.
- You can adjust the amount of sugar in the drink to your liking. If you like your drinks sweeter, add more sugar. If you prefer a less sweet drink, reduce the amount of sugar.
- For a creamier drink, add some milk or yogurt.
- You can also add other fruits to the drink, such as bananas, mangoes, or pineapples.
